re PR fortran/18109 (ICE with explicit array of strings)
2005-05-30 Paul Thomas <pault@gcc.gnu.org> PR fortran/18109 PR fortran/18283 PR fortran/19107 * fortran/trans-array.c (gfc_conv_expr_descriptor): Obtain the string length from the expression typespec character length value and set temp_ss->stringlength and backend_decl. Obtain the tree expression from gfc_conv_expr rather than gfc_conv_expr_val. Dereference the expression to obtain the character. * fortran/trans-expr.c (gfc_conv_component_ref): Remove the dereference of scalar character pointer structure components. * fortran/trans-expr.c (gfc_trans_subarray_assign): Obtain the string length for the structure component from the component expression.
